PAPPY's blog
I was reading his blog this afternoon, and he questioned whether some of us who dislike Shields, dislike him more for his style of play more so than for his won and loss record. I do prefer a more up-tempo game, personally, but not run and gun playground ball, but If you've been reading this board on a regular basis, you'll know that I really didn't complain much about Shields up until about two years ago. When we were winning 18 games or so for a while, I thought perhaps that he could eventually get us to the tournament. I finally decided that he won't ever get us there, not necessarily because of the his style of play, but because he can't recruit the caliber of players necessary to beat the better teams in the league. This season just added fuel to the fire. Good programs led by good coaches don't go from twenty plus wins to twenty plus losses in one year. You can have down years in a good program, but not years that end up looking like a train wreck. Just want to clear that up with PAPPY why I am past ready for a change in coaches. Seven years is enough time to get it done. If he can't do it in seven years, the chances are slim that he ever will.
